Vettel: The biggest enemy is me

Had it been an isolated incident, fans of both Sebastian Vettel and Ferrari would not have been quite so quick to claim that the German has blown his 2018 title hopes. However, as he gambled on a move on Lewis Hamilton at the second chicane at Monza, clashing with the Briton's Mercedes and spinning, dropping down the order in the process, it followed mistakes at Azerbaijan and again at Hockenheim where he made an unforced error whilst leading his home Grand Prix. Aware that Hamilton now has a thirty-point lead, it was a sombre Vettel who faced the media in Singapore today. 'I think it is pretty straightforward for me,' he told reporters.
